Greg Blache (the same guy who supposedly told the Bears to go after Vick's knees) really has a lot of respect for the Bills offense. He recognized a lot of Gilbride "run and shoot" philosophy and said how the Bills have 2 WR who have more catches than Marty Booker, the Bear go-to guy. At first he was looking forward to the Bills game because the Bears started against Culpepper, Vick, and Brooks. They could tee off and go after a stationary Drew. Blache also said that when he was with the Colts, they felt that they could rattle Drew if they hit him enough.
The Bears lost another DB (Gray) so 2 of the 4 opening day starters aren't going to play. Plus they lost Tony Parrish to FA, and haven't gotten much of a pass rush so far.
